Moores Hill South
Moores Hill South is a peak in Hurunui District, Canterbury and has an elevation of 312 metres.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Omihi or Ōmihi is a rural community in the Hurunui District of the Canterbury Region, on New Zealand's South Island. It is located 21km north-east of Amberley.

Waikari is a small town in the Canterbury region of New Zealand's South Island. Its Anglican parish church is the Church of Ascension, 79 Princes Street, Waikari, where William Orange was vicar in the 1920s. Waikari is situated 10 km west of Moores Hill South.
